[PATCH] dns: Delete dnsNode objects when they are empty

Kai Blin kai at samba.org
Sat Jun 1 02:24:11 MDT 2013


If an update leaves the dnsNode without any entries, the dnsNode object
should be deleted. Thanks to Günter Kukkukk for his excellent debugging
work on this one.

This should fix bug #9559

diff --git a/source4/dns_server/dns_utils.c b/source4/dns_server/dns_utils.c
index 21c7f5a..72782cf 100644
--- a/source4/dns_server/dns_utils.c
+++ b/source4/dns_server/dns_utils.c
@@ -276,7 +276,13 @@ WERROR dns_replace_records(struct dns_server *dns,
 		if (needs_add) {
 			return WERR_OK;
 		}
-		/* TODO: Delete object? */
+		/* No entries left, delete the dnsNode object */
+		ret = ldb_delete(dns->samdb, msg->dn);
+		if (ret != LDB_SUCCESS) {
+			DEBUG(0, ("Deleting record failed; %d\n", ret));
+			return DNS_ERR(SERVER_FAILURE);
+		}
+		return WERR_OK;
 	}
